Salvador Dalí, Surrealistic Flowers (Hermocallis Thumergill Elephanter Furiosa)

1972 lithograph on paper Inventory number 545 The translation for the title of this piece of work is the ‘Furious Daylily Elephant’. In this lithograph Dalì has depicted an elephant, seemingly mid-stamp and with trunk raised, entirely made from a daylily. Philippe Halsman, Dalì Skull

1951 silver gelatin photographic print on paper Inventory number 2043 This image is the result of a collaboration between photographer Philippe Halsman and artist Salvador Dalì.  They worked together to create this image, inspired from a sketch drawn by Dalì.
